A pee string is what many show breeders use, especially if they have a long coat, it directs the urine away from the coat. If your dog has a short coat this isn't as important, although I know some people complain about their dogs getting urine on their tummy or inside legs. Joey's breeder leaves the string on even though Joeys coat is short now. No dribbles with a pee string! By the way, the hair doesn't have to be thick on the pee string or even very long.
